Q: Is 42,834,782 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 42,834,782 is a composite number.

Why is 42,834,782 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 42,834,782 can be evenly divided by 1 2 2,179 4,358 9,829 19,658 21,417,391 and 42,834,782, with no remainder.

Since 42,834,782 cannot be divided by just 1 and 42,834,782, it is a composite number.
